What are South Carolina's requirements for purchasing a firearm from a gun shop near Parris Island?

In South Carolina, to purchase a firearm from a licensed dealer like those near Parris Island, you must be at least 18 for long guns and 21 for handguns, pass a federal NICS background check, and show valid government-issued photo ID with current address. There is no state permit required for purchase, but some local shops may have additional policies for military personnel stationed at MCAS Beaufort or Parris Island.

Do gun shops in the Parris Island area offer FFL transfers for online purchases, and what are typical fees?

Yes, shops like Palmetto State Armory, Lowcountry Firearms, and The Arms Room in the Parris Island area commonly handle FFL transfers for online firearm purchases. Transfer fees in South Carolina typically range from $25 to $50 per firearm, but it's best to contact the specific shop in advance to confirm their current rates, paperwork requirements, and appointment policies.

What should military personnel stationed at Parris Island know about buying firearms in South Carolina?

Military personnel stationed at Parris Island can purchase firearms in South Carolina using their military ID along with proof of local residence, such as base housing documentation or utility bills. However, they should be aware that South Carolina does not recognize out-of-state concealed carry permits for residents, so obtaining a SC CWP is recommended if they plan to carry concealed locally.
